COMMONWEALTH OF AUSTRALIA (Civil Aviation Regulations 1998), PART 39 - 107 CIVIL AVIATION SAFETY AUTHORITY
SCHEDULE OF AIRWORTHINESS DIRECTIVES
Electrical Equipment
AD/ELECT/23 Nickel Cadmium Batteries with Polystyrene
Cell Cases - Inspection and Replacement
1/72
Applicability: Any nickel cadmium battery, containing polystyrene cell cases, that is capable of being used to start an aircraft engine or A.P.U., except those installed in aircraft which have the battery charging automatically controlled as a function of battery temperature.
Requirement: 1. Visually inspect each battery including the cell links and cell tops for evidence of heat damage.
2. (a) Replace each cell having a polystyrene case with an equivalent cell having a nylon case; OR
2. (b) Replace any battery containing any polystyrene cell cases with a battery which is approved for aircraft use containing all nylon cells.
Compliance: For Para. 1 - Within 30 hours time in service after 28 January 1972 and thereafter at intervals not exceeding 7 days for a battery that is used for an engine or A.P.U. start, or attempted start, until replacement of the battery in accordance with para. 2.
For Para. 2 - Any battery found to have evidence of heat damage - before further flight, and for any other battery before 1 August 1972.
Note 1: Polystyrene cell cases can be identified by their clear or slight yellow plastic appearance. Marathon (Sonotone) batteries manufactured prior to 1969 (Type CA20, CA20H and CA21H) contained polystyrene cell cases. Marathon batteries manufactured in 1969 or later and those manufactured by others contain nylon cells which can be identified by their milky white or bluish appearance.
Note 2: Any battery rebuilt since new may contain a mixture of polystyrene and nylon cells.
